Transaction 5898351504e7b49d6985ec107bc537b988f9ac7a7c28a408f874a6a4c23d26ee

2 Input
2 Outputs
  • 5898351504e7b49d6985ec107bc537b988f9ac7a7c28a408f874a6a4c23d26ee:0
  • value  96430
    address  3MA8ZnDM8tKkxwuejSgCGjmKkC4Kx9PY3p
  • 5898351504e7b49d6985ec107bc537b988f9ac7a7c28a408f874a6a4c23d26ee:1
  • value  1347726
    address  3M3rkCDp1Ezy1C3mxxJ7QaSMHywAqjJd1T